What is the definition of personal branding?
Self-packaging is the basis of personal branding. It’s about taking control of how others perceive yourself professionally by making sure you highlight your unique skills and talents. A strong personal brand creates an image that makes potential employers to understand what sets you apart from other people in your area of expertise.
What is the importance of personal branding for success in your career?
Your personal brand is the thing people think of you, even if you aren’t. People will develop an opinion about your character as an professional, whether or not you’re actively creating your personal brand.
Being able to distinguish yourself in today’s job market from other candidates is essential. Employers are now looking for candidates who align with their image. They are looking for people who have established themselves with compelling storytelling on social media platforms, such as LinkedIn and Twitter, platforms that were made specifically for professional networking.
Without creating your own brand identity by defining your unique skillset through practical examples shared online, as well as real testimonials from colleagues; hiring managers would often struggle to differentiate from other qualified candidates.
The creation of a solid personal brand is more than having a clean resume or cover letter It also involves actively marketing yourself using various online channels efficiently. The identity you present is vital for major events like salary negotiations or annual performance reviews which could affect your professional career.
How to build a strong image for yourself
Here are some ideas to help you build strong brands.
Create a brand identity
Begin by defining your brand identity. It is possible to identify your distinct value proposition through combining an introspective and external assessment.
What is it that makes you different? What have you done to overcome obstacles? Utilize these skills to build an online and offline presence.
Use social media to your advantage
The job market is increasingly populated by social media platforms such as Twitter as well as LinkedIn. Check that all information is correct will contribute to the development of important professional networks whether followers or connections, such as articles or industry-relevant discussions. Upload high-quality images that supports your knowledge of the industry Correct grammar and punctuation must be a requirement.
Discuss ideas with others.
Provide regular insights into issues that are relevant to your expertise via podcasts or blogs. Engage with those who comment on the article through any feedback channel on the internet and this encourages dialogue invariably leading to positive conversations. This way it is not just that people will connect with your content but you could also consider inviting them for speaking engagements - great opportunities to show off your expertise!
Participate and be visible:
It is not only important to be prominent within industry networking as well as out of them! Going to events such as conferences, workshops and participating in community initiatives that relate to the business is a great way to show your enthusiasm for it. It also shows you that you care about the development of your business.

FAQs
What is personal branding?
Personal branding is the act of promoting your personal and professional life as an individual brand. Personal branding is the process of creating an identity to communicate your talents, interests and values via your online presence, your overall image, and your professional image.
Why is personal branding so important for career success?
Personal branding can help you differentiate you from other professionals in your area of expertise. A strong personal branding will boost your credibility, visibility and authority within your field. It will also allow you to find new avenues to develop your career and progress.
How do I build a personal brand for myself?
- Start by identifying the unique strengths, abilities and areas of expertise.
- Create a message that clearly explains who you are as well as the services you offer.
- Make sure you have a consistent presence online on platforms such as LinkedIn or Twitter.
- Blog posts or social media updates could help you share valuable content on your expertise or industry.
- Network with other professionals in your industry, both online and offline.
Do I benefit from personal branding even if I don’t work in a creative industry?
Yes! Professionals in all fields can profit from a personal brand. When you apply for a job or seek promotions, a strong brand will help you stand out from the competition. You can establish yourself as an expert in your field.
Does it make sense to have an individual website for my personal branding efforts?
A personal website is not essential, but it can be beneficial. But having some sort of online presence, like having a LinkedIn profile or a professional social media accounts is highly recommended to showcase your skills and expertise to prospective employers or customers.
